One of Nietzsche's quotes on death is "He who has a why to live can bear almost any how." This quote suggests that having a purpose or meaning in life can help one cope with the inevitability of death. Another quote is "To die proudly when it is no longer possible to live proudly." This quote emphasizes the importance of maintaining one's dignity and integrity even in the face of death.

One of Seneca's most profound quotes on death is "We are more often frightened than hurt; and we suffer more from imagination than from reality." This quote reflects his belief that our fear of death is often worse than death itself. Another powerful quote is "Death is a release from the impressions of the senses, and from desires that make us their puppets, and from the vagaries of the mind, and from the hard service of the flesh." Seneca sees death as a liberation from the struggles and limitations of earthly life.

One powerful stoic death quote is from Marcus Aurelius: "Do not act as if you were going to live ten thousand years. Death hangs over you. While you live, while it is in your power, be good." This quote reminds us of the impermanence of life and the importance of living virtuously.
